School Overview

Steger Sixth Grade Ctr. is a public school located in St Louis, Missouri. It is a school in Webster Groves School District district.

According to the Missouri state assessment result, 62% of students are proficient in Math learning and 61%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

It has 346 students through grade 6 to 6. The students to teacher ratio is 13 to 1 where a total of 26 teachers are teaching for the school.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 26 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for Steger Sixth Grade Ctr. and the students to teacher ratio is 13 to 1. All teachers are certified. 96.2%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
